Braves Trade Pitcher Todd Redmond To Reds For
Shortstop Paul Janish

The Braves acquire some help at shortstop in Paul Janish.

The Atlanta Braves have acquired backup shortstop Paul Janish from the Cincinnati Reds in exchange for pitcher Todd Redmond. Janish is currently playing at triple-A Louisville, and Redmond has been a career minor leaguer, currently playing at triple-A Gwinett.

Janish should be considered purely a backup, as his .237/.332/.391 slash line this year at triple-A tells us. He has major league experience, having spent the last four seasons with the Reds. He's an excellent defender, and should give the Braves a little more bat at the shortstop position than Jack Wilson.

Redmond has been toiling away at triple-A for several years. He got his first call up to the Majors earlier this year, but never appeared in a game. He should be a durable back of the rotation starter or long reliever for a Major League team.

Decent trade by the Braves. They acquire a defense-first shortstop to pair with Wilson, but they trade away some starting pitching depth, though as an option, Redmond was down the list.

Yankees Sign First Round Pick Hensley

From Tim Bontemps:

It took some time, but the Yankees got their man.

Friday ? the final day to sign players taken in last month?s First-Year Player Draft ? the Yankees came to terms with high school right-hander Ty Hensley, the team?s first-round pick and the 30th overall selection in the draft.

Hensley, a hard thrower who was committed to Ole Miss, where he was expected to play every day because of his strong bat, reportedly signed for $1.2 million, saving the Yankees a few hundred thousand dollars on the $1.6 million slot price at that pick.

Those savings allowed them to spend money in later rounds on other players, such as Utah high school right-hander Brady Lail, an 18th-round selection who signed for $225,000.

Hensley, who was ranked No. 23 overall by Baseball America entering the draft, throws a mid-90s fastball to go along with a curve, and was athletic enough to play quarterback at Sante Fe High School in Edmond, Okla., until his senior year, when he gave up the sport to focus on baseball.

Astros History: Mark Portugal Is Acquired

December 4, 1988, Bill Wood traded career Minor League player Todd McClure to the Minnesota Twins for Mark Portugal.

Portugal would pitch five wonderful years in Houston, posting a 52-30 record and a 108 ERA+. In Minnesota he had been a below average pitcher, but after coming to Houston he suddenly became above average and I don't mean slightly above average. I mean well above average. Sure his career 108 ERA+ is slightly above average but in three of those five years he posted an ERA+ of at least 124.

Granted the two 120 seasons he had he pitched just over a 100 innings, however, in his best season he pitched over 200 innings and that was thankfully in Houston.

In 1993 Portugal pitched a career high 208 innings and posted a 139 ERA+, also a career high. He made 33 starts that years and posted an 18-4 record. Portugal would be allowed to enter free agency after the 1993 season. The new general manager at the time, Bob Watson, apparently didn't think enough of Portugal to resign him after his career season.

Smart move by Watson, who saw Portugal sign with San Francisco. In the season and a half with the Giants Portugal posted a 99 ERA+. He would have somewhat of a rebound with Cincinnati but never posted numbers as good as he did with Houston.

Overall Portugal was the prototypical average pitcher at the Major League level. Houston was lucky enough to get some above average years from him.
